## Training Video Studio — Room B-14 Access

The recording studio in B-14 is managed by the facilities desk. Sessions must be booked through the studio calendar; walk-ins are not permitted because lighting and sound equipment stays rigged between shoots. Issue visiting presenters a day badge and remind them the red lamp means recording in progress. Equipment sign-out sheets are kept in the wall pocket by the mixer. The studio door locks at all times; facilities staff admitting a booked session should use the keypad code below.

staff pass of kagup-fajog = bdg-QCHVQW-99665837

**14:22 — Stale-cache root cause confirmed**

Quick context for newer folks: the Pondermill edge cache was serving week-old pricing pages because the purge job silently skipped keys with uppercase prefixes. Marta from the Fennwick team spotted it while diffing responses. We flipped the purge matcher to case-insensitive and redeployed. The fix shipped under the trace token below.

pipeline stamp: htk6_c0ef30

Hi Dorit,

As I hand over the Wavecrest preview service, here's what plugin authors need to know. The waveform preview renderer caches peak data per track, and external plugins query that cache rather than decoding audio themselves. Please remind authors that cache entries expire after 48 hours and must be regenerated through the official endpoint. Metadata for every rendered preview lives in the peaks database, which you can reach with the connection string below.

replica DSN, kajep-yahag: mssql://praok_svc:iF@db-8d68.plorvaio.local:5432/eliion

### Account Recovery — Catalogue Import (Lintwood)

Quick one for review: when the Lintwood catalogue import wipes a patron's session table, the recovery flow re-seeds accounts from the nightly snapshot. Check that the importer skips locked accounts — last time it didn't. To rerun recovery against staging you'll need the vault passphrase, which is appended just below.

recovery phrase for yafof-tajof: julmir-kelax-julvan-holath-belvan-holir-ralael-ralvan-ralath-julvan-silmir-istmir-kaswyn-ulamir